General Concerns
When selecting any vendor, it's essential to understand their staff composition, financial background, and locations. These fundamental topics provide insight into the prospective system integrator's stability and reliability.
Manufacturing Capabilities
Your partner should have the tools, processes, and resources to meet your current needs and grow with you. This includes support from product development through production and beyond. Industry Standards and Quality
A robust integration partner should demonstrate how it tracks quality at various checkpoints in the manufacturing process. Internal Standards and Practices
Understand the internal standards or practices that guide the quality of their work. Partners with solid values and procedures often produce more consistent work, which is crucial for complying with quality, environmental, and government standards.
Technology Partnerships
When you contract with a systems integrator, you're also hiring their network of technology partners.
